WebChipboard is made from reconstituted wood, usually chips, shavings, and sawdust, which are subject to high temperatures and pressure. Once cooled, the boards are sanded and cut to the right size. Standard chipboard sheets are 2400mm x 600mm and are available in two thicknesses, 18mm and 22mm. The benefits of using chipboard flooring WebChipboard Flooring. WebOne of the biggest benefits of West Fraser’s chipboard products is the security and stability whatever the weather. The CaberDek ® flooring panel comes with a 42-day weather resistance guarantee and the CaberShieldPlus ® P5 chipboard panel offers and impressive 60 days of weather resistance when laid in accordance with fitting instructions.
